The Impact of Music on Storytelling
Music has an incredible ability to shape how we experience a story. It sets the mood, guides our emotions, and even influences our understanding of the characters. Imagine watching a scene where a couple is falling in love. Without music, the scene might be sweet, but with the right Pakistani drama song, it can become truly magical. The music can highlight the tenderness, the longing, the unspoken words between them. Conversely, music can be used to create tension and suspense. A slow, haunting melody can build anticipation before a dramatic reveal or a shocking plot twist. The use of minor keys, dissonant chords, and unusual instrumentation can create a sense of unease, keeping the audience on the edge of their seats. Music also helps to define the characters. The choice of music can reflect their personality, their background, and their emotional state. A rebellious character might have a song with a strong beat and powerful vocals, while a more introspective character might have a song with a softer, more melancholic feel. The lyrics often provide additional insights into the characters' thoughts and feelings, deepening our connection with them. The success of a drama often hinges on how well the music complements the visuals and the script. The music should never feel out of place or intrusive; instead, it should seamlessly integrate into the storytelling, enhancing the overall impact of the scenes. When done well, the music can elevate a scene from good to unforgettable, leaving a lasting impression on the audience. It’s no wonder that music directors and composers are highly valued members of any drama production team in Pakistan, ensuring that the songs and background scores are expertly crafted to meet the specific requirements of each scene.

From Traditional to Contemporary
In the early days, Pakistani drama songs often featured traditional instruments like the sitar, tabla, and dholak, along with melodies that drew inspiration from classical and folk music. The focus was on beautiful melodies and heartfelt lyrics that resonated with a broad audience. However, as the industry matured, new influences began to emerge. Composers started experimenting with different genres, incorporating elements of pop, rock, and electronic music. Production techniques also advanced, allowing for more complex arrangements and a richer sound. This evolution reflects the changing tastes of the audience and the growing desire for diversity in music. The industry has embraced these changes, resulting in a vibrant and dynamic music scene. This trend signifies a shift toward a more modern and inclusive approach to creating music. It recognizes the power of music to reflect societal changes and to connect with people on a deeper level.
